Show Notes

The Apostle Philip came from Bethsaida and town with many Greek influences.  It appears that he was Martyred by combining both Roman and Jewish execution styles.  The Apostle Nathanael who had to overcome some initial prejudices to become a Disciple of Jesus was instrumental in taking the Gospel to Armenia.  He was finally Martyred in AD 70.
